19th Century English Brass Calendar and Letter Holder
About the Item
A handsome, stately desk calendar and letter holder from the Victorian era. It's hand-forged from solid brass, which one can feel from the weight of the piece. The antique brass has a rich and lustrous patina, that reflects the light nicely to highlight the detail of its craftsmanship. I find it appealing how such a simple calendaring system still works reliably in our uber tech-driven times. This piece would hold quite a bit of charm sitting on a 21st century desk, even in the most modern of studies.
- Dimensions:Height: 7 in (17.78 cm)Width: 8 in (20.32 cm)Depth: 6 in (15.24 cm)
- Style:High Victorian (Of the Period)
- Materials and Techniques:Brass,Forged
- Place of Origin:
- Period:
- Date of Manufacture:circa 1885
- Condition:Wear consistent with age and use. This desk calendar is in excellent condition. The wear noted is really just found in the patina, which adds to its character and value.
